Output d1753d3fad8b3dd769094180fbe40d266156bfc402aaa31715483a0f6a609643:0
- value
- 37502079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d4535b61da8c5ab8053999ef140de35e31d7259 OP_EQUAL
- address
- 3MrzAiixojq2j3NGPeep4NZNQBFoQQmnkh
- transaction
- d1753d3fad8b3dd769094180fbe40d266156bfc402aaa31715483a0f6a609643
- confirmations
- 363396
- spent
- true